Original Manuscript Poem, titled “Old England,” by Phineas Smith, four pages on two adjoining sheets, 7.5 x 12.5. Although titled “Old England,” this poem is a definite mocking jab at the “Mother country,” as it includes a litany of famous American figures and their successes in fighting against the British from the Revolutionary War through the current War of 1812 period. Poem begins:
“Old England forty years ago
When we were young and slender
She aimed at us a mortal blow
But God was our Defender.
Jehovah saw the horrid plan
Great Washington he gave us
His holiness inspired the man
With power and skill to save us
She sent her fleets and armies over
To ravage hill and plunder
Our heroes met them on the shore
And beat them back with thunder”
Poem goes on to reference historic events, battles and name-dropping of the likes of Decatur, Perry, Breckenridge, Madison, Macombs, and others. In fair condition, with partial separations along fragile horizontal folds, old tape reinforcement to hinge, scattered moderate toning and soiling, and a few brushes to text.
